Will a Romanian Lever Side Folder work on an OOW receiver?  I know I'll have to do alittle dremel work probably but how big a pain in the ass is this gonna be?

Joe
Link Posted: 3/9/2005 10:08:33 AM EDT
[#1]
I doubt you will have to do any dremel work if you're installing a Rommy side folder.  They mate up to a standard rear trunnion that is used for solid stocks.  All you have to do is remove the fixed stock on your rifle and slide the Rommy in its place.  You may have to do some minor fitting but nothing major.
Link Posted: 3/9/2005 11:34:51 AM EDT
[#2]
Beings that the receiver on the OOW is thicker it will not fit as easily, you will have to do some grinding.  For example, I had an East German folder, not the same design as the Romanian, but it would slide in my SAR2 no problem.  Tried to fit the same folder into my OOW receiver and it would not go in without some grinding.  I left the OOW with a fixed and put the folder on my SAR2.
